Chris Wyles - Loyal Eagle

Chris Wyles has been a supremely important player for the USA national teams.

He was a steadying force through some pretty serious upheavals, and as he retires from international 15s duty, it's worth looking back and tipping your hat.

Eagles Will Look Very Different in February

The retirement of Chris Wyles from playing 15s for the USA is the latest in what should be a series of shifts for the USA Men’s National Team this year.
